See more at:Jumblat Says Port Fire Sought to ‘Destroy Evidence’
by Naharnet Newsdesk 3 hours ago
Progressive Socialist party leader ex-MP Walid Jumblat said Friday the fire that broke out at Beirut port yesterday sought to “demolish evidence” in the case of the colossal Beirut blast earlier in August.
“They burnt evidence fearing a bold investigator with a conscientious or fearing an honest employee and those are many in this criminal administration,” said Jumblat in a tweet.
Jumblat went on saying that “this authority will not escape punishment.”
